I use steel toe work boots. They're comparatively really cheap and the thick rubber soles keep me connected to the wheel without sacrificing comfort.

I lace them nice and tight and so far they've saved my ankles a few time while riding single-track.

I have friends who want lighter footwear to feel the wheel better but having tried this I'm not sure exactly what it is they're hoping to feel. I'm locked into the pedals well enough that I seem to feel any movement nearly as though I'm standing directly on the pedals.

The locked ankles have me lose some agility, which is worth it for me for the added safety. I also don't ride trails that are advanced enough to require every last drop of possible agility. My Sherman L extra weight is actually a much higher hindrence in that regard and I seem to power through everything I'm interested is accomplishing just fine.

Honestly I highly recommend this route if you want to avoid expensive motorcycle boots. Though if you have the extra cash I imagine motorcycle boots are the best option.

For me, seeing how many of Haskell's besoke type-level features all sort of more or less intuitively follow from dependent types was really eye opening.

Lean doesn't have and doesn't want higher kinds, generics, etc. Even learning what a type class is in Lean is smoother because of how with Lean it just feel like it's expanding on when you can make a parameter implicit (something that becomes intuitive pretty early)

I really enjoy seeing a whole host of abstractions reified under a system that feels simpler.


Though I'd love to see linear types in Lean, the attemps I've seen so far feel like type socery to me again (macros expanding into somethig wild) 🤷‍♂️
